This large casebound coffee-table size volume contains superb coloured pictures, finely detailed maps and extensive text and track notes describing Australia's top 25 bushwalking areas.Topics discussed in the text include: access, walking grades, weather, notes on geology and botany, track notes and suitable campsites. The areas described are: Hinchinbrook Island, Carnarvon Gorge, the Main Range, Lamington Rainforests, Mount Barney, the Warrumbungles, the Upper Grose Valley of the Blue Mountains, the Budawang Range, the Snowy Mountains, the Victorian Alps, Wilson's Promontory, Grampian Ranges, the Overland Track, the Walls of Jerusalem, the South Coast Track, Mount Anne, Federation Peak, the Western Arthur Range, Frenchman's Cap, Wilpena Pound, the Gammon Ranges, the Stirling Ranges, the Fitzgerald River Coast, Katherine Gorge and Kakadu National Park.
